A few days ago I presented my second cut of my film trailer. This cut consisted of the changed shots, the ADR’d sound and the re-editing of the first sequence. Overall it was very positive feedback with everyone understanding the genre that the film is and with all audio aspects of the trailer clear to hear.
Things to change
The things that need to be change to the shot of ‘Jake’ at the start of the trailer, this needs to be longer as it is very hard to se his face due to the quickness of the edit. Other things that need to be changed around is the language at the start of the trailer. After doing some research I found that strong language is aloud in a trailer providing that there is a restricted rating placed at the start to inform audiences. However, when viewing this trailer it seems like the strong language comes to early on and therefore will be taken out. The last thing that needed to be altered was the voice over. As it stands the voice used is much too high pitched and does give enough information about the film, so I need to do a re-write and re-record.
